About the role
Key responsibilities & impact- Leading the development, optimization, and validation of spatial genomics and molecular profiling assays to support neuroscience, oncology, and immunology programs.
- Designing and executing experimental workflows involving tissue processing, immunohistochemistry, in situ hybridization, microscopy, high‑resolution slide imaging and sequencing.
- Establishing and refining new molecular assays, including troubleshooting, workflow development, and technical feasibility assessments.
- Building and scaling laboratory infrastructure, including lab setup, instrumentation planning, and operational readiness.
- Managing CROs and external partners, ensuring high‑quality data generation, timeline alignment, and technical deliverables.
- Collaborating closely with therapeutic area teams to translate multiomics and spatial readouts into actionable biological insights.
- Contributing to data workflows by supporting early-stage data mapping, QC frameworks, and analytical handoffs to computational teams.
Requirements
What you’ll need- Minimum of a PhD in Genetics, Genomics, Molecular Biology, Molecular Pathology, Systems biology, Human biology or a related discipline is required.
- Post-doctoral fellowship in a related field is required.
- A minimum of 6 years of biotech or pharmaceutical industry experience is required.
- Strong track record of high-impact scientific deliverables as evidenced by publications, presentations, and recognition within the scientific community.
- Deep, technical spatial omics expertise is required, including understanding of end-to-end workflows, methods limitations, and mitigation strategies.
- Excellent written communication, verbal communication, and oral presentation skills are required.
- Experience with Multiomic Datasets is required.
- Demonstrated ability to work across disciplines and functional areas is required.
- Ability to apply novel approaches to address complex biology questions, as evidenced through strong peer-reviewed publications is required.
- Proficiency in programming languages such as R or Python is preferred.
- In vitro cell culture and genomics library design experience is preferred.
- Experience as a problem solver, and team collaborator able to facilitate understanding between biologists and data scientists is preferred.
- Ability to manage multiple projects and meet deadlines is preferred.
- Experience working with and/or guiding external collaborators in industry or academia is preferred.
